When considering what hardware you want and especially if you are looking to keep the rack at a working level, there are lots of choices. A lot of them will make you smile. Only a few of them will make you say instantly, "There it is...."

So you go into a nice studio with a great console and racks and racks of outboard to track some songs. The engineer puts selected tracks through track numbers that already have all the tie lines in place. You look around and notice there are a multiple number of LA2A's, 1176's, Pultecs and API 550's. There are other classics, but usually only one of each. You won't often see three or four API 2500's or Neve 33609's in a room for example.

There's a reason. Still. Today. From devices brought out in the 1960's. Pultec's are even older. And here we are. Already 16 years into the 2nd millenium and we haven't gotten all that far with what our ears want to hear.

About the Warm stuff. The Pultec emulations are very good. I own a WA 76 and like it alot. I think it doesn't have the headroom a real 1176 has, but it is MORE than usable at a very very good price. So, it could be a bargain for what you get.

I have 16 channels of hardware compression. I track most things that come through my room. Sometimes the patchbay is full. Other times its all about the pre choice and mic placement and no need to compress going in. That being said, the ONLY compressors I could NOT do without are the LA2A's and the 1176. The others are nice too and have a certain character. The 502 Grace is a wonderful optical comp. Sweet and really fast. The Retro Doublewide is an excellent comp for voice and guitar. The SC2 1.07 Meek is sorta a specialty. The modded ART VLA is wonderful on taking the edgy attack out of a bright acoustic instrument and to fatten horns. The DBX 160SL is a great drum overheads comp as well as spoken word.....but they are all specialty items as opposed to the LA2A and 1176 circuits.

I think that looking at the type of circuit that creates the compression, the speed and release is the real key to choosing what is best for a room. Optical, FET, and Vari-Mu are all different animals.

Passive summing produces a smaller version of the algebraic sum of the inputs (but see caveat below). You need amplification of the sum bus (2-bus) to get back to line level. This is where character of the signal can come in, either deliberately when choosing which external box to use to perform the amplification, or by default if the summing box does resistive summing but has a built-in 2-channel make-up amplifier.

The caveat: a passive summing box sums the currents generated by applying the channel input voltages to resistors. However, all resistors change their resistance by a small amount as a function of applied voltage, that is, they are non-linear. The amount of change is dependent on a number of things including the type of resistor (metal film, wirewound, carbon etc), the nominal resistance value and the packaging (through-hole or surface-mount). It's the designer's job to minimize the distortion caused by non-linearity in the summing resistances by careful circuit design and component choice, and then insist that the production department sticks to what the designer has specified.

I have told the story before of a contract design I did for a well-known company where, to minimize distortion, I had specified three through-hole resistors in series in the feedback path from the output op-amps. The hand-built prototypes sounded really nice, which was more than could be said for the pre-production versions from the factory. Amongst other things, I found they had substituted a single surface-mount resistor of the correct value for the three through-hole parts in the prototypes. Their excuse for that particular horror was that they thought I had not been able to buy parts of the right value, and that I had strung three together to get the right resistance.

The upshot of all this is that different makes of passive summing boxes can actually sound different.

kmetal, post: 439018, member: 37533 wrote: Is it a safe take away, that passive summing boxes, although they vary in tone, they vary less than their active counterparts? Assuming similar levels of build/design quality between the products?

Also, does the line of thinking you outlined, also apply to other devices that can be passive or active, like a DI box, or re-amping box?

Yes, it does, but is usually masked by non-linearities in other parts of the circuit. It's only when you get to a unit that is billed as "passive" that you have the chance to make comparisons without active components getting in the way. Don't get me wrong, some of these components with small non-linearities (e.g. transformers) can make a great contribution to the sound. It's up to the experience and imagination of the design engineer to make sure the good effects come through the design and then the production process with minimal negative impact from the bad effects.

ulysses, post: 439030, member: 9729 wrote: Any differences between resistors would exist in any circuit that uses resistors, including active summing boxes. And then you have the variations in all the other components on top of that. But it's my professional opinion that you would need to work hard to develop a circuit that can produce measurable and audible differences at its output attributable solely to the resistor package.

You can hear things you cannot easily measure. In the gross instance that I related, I could measure the differences using a distortion analyser. That's unusual, and it confirms that they were severe. Effects of this sort are difficult to quantify with any certainty, but they can easily be heard. It's one of the reasons why you can't develop great-sounding audio gear simply by sitting at a bench in a lab, no matter how well-equipped.
